Residential Water Damage Restoration Cost In Lee, MA

The cost of residential water damage restoration can vary based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Lee, MA. Here are some estimates for common services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water removal and drying $500 – $2,500 The size of the affected area and the amount of water that needs to be removed.
Cleaning and sanitizing $500 – $2,000 The extent of the damage and the number of surfaces that need to be cleaned and sanitized.
Repair and reconstruction $1,000 – $5,000 The extent of the damage and the number of materials that need to be replaced.
Inspection and assessment Free – $500 The complexity of the job and the amount of equipment that needs to be used.
Equipment and labor costs $500 – $2,000 The type and quality of equipment used and the number of hours worked.
More services (e.g. Mold remediation) $500 – $2,000 The extent of the damage and the number of services required.
